Gauge Theory Seminar: Aganagic’s invariant is Khovanov homology

Speaker: Elise LePage (Columbia)

Recently, Aganagic proposed a categorification of quantum link invariants (corresponding to U_q(g) where g is an ADE Lie algebra) using Lagrangian Floer theory in multiplicative Coulomb branches equipped with a potential. Her original proposal was based on insights from string theory, but the resulting definition of categorified link invariants can be made mathematically rigorous. In this talk, I will review her proposal for link invariants and explain my recent proof (joint with Vivek Shende) that Aganagic’s invariant recovers Khovanov homology in the case g=sl(2).
